Case Summary: 80/2022 Court Decision: The court convicted Appellant 1 (Vijayabhai alias Bandabhai Adabhai Thakor) under IPC Section 325 (causing hurt by dangerous weapon) and sentenced him to one year rigorous imprisonment plus ₹5,000 fine (or additional 30 days imprisonment if fine unpaid). The other three appellants (Appellants 2, 3, and 4) were acquitted due to insufficient evidence, given benefit of doubt under criminal procedure rules. Key Facts: On July 15, 2021, a roadside altercation occurred when the injured complainant's vehicle obstructed traffic. Appellant 1 struck the complainant's left elbow with an iron pipe, causing fracture requiring hospitalization and surgery. Medical evidence confirmed the serious injury. Reasoning: The court relied heavily on the injured eyewitness's credible testimony, supported by corroborating evidence from the accompanying witness and medical documentation. While some embellishment existed regarding other appellants' roles, the core facts establishing Appellant 1's guilt remained unshaken beyond reasonable doubt.
